A smooth path generation approach for sensor-based coverage path planning

Abstract
In this study, a path smoothing strategy is proposed for sensor-based coverage problems. Smooth paths are generated for the coverage problems considering mobile robot kinematics constraints. An open agent architecture-based control structure is used to implement the proposed approach on real robots. The algorithm is coded with C++ and implemented on P3-DX mobile robots in MobileSim simulation environments. It is shown that the proposed approach smoothes the curves and robot easily turns the corners. As a result of this, the completion time of the coverage decreases.
